        Re: Help choosing sliders

        Drtro has a good idea (and not just because he mentioned my sets lol).

        Start tweaking your sliders based on what's hard/easy for you. Ultimately, any slider set is going to need tailoring to you. As you learn the game and get better, that will lead to more tweaking as well.

        Starting with default and going from there is excellent advice. If you start putting up 80% completion with any scrub QB, you'll know it's time to turn your QB Accuracy down. If you struggle running the ball right now, increase your run blocking, things like that.

        Then you can enjoy the game and your team as you learn, and when you do improve, you can start making things harder for your in those areas as you develop.

        Also, don't be afraid to just experiment. See what something does. Heck, that's how a lot of slider makers on this forum come up with things and are still coming up with things. If you don't like something you're seeing - mess with the slider for it. See what happens (use a different CCM so you don't mess up your "main" files with the experimenting).

            Re: Help choosing sliders

            For months I played on All-Pro with INT and RBK set to 25 and had fun. But I wanted to get a more realistic "ratings matter" and started going with all 0 sets.


            Just start with a default difficulty. Play 3-4 games and take notes.
            If the running is too easy, turn down run block.
            If you threw 9 interceptions in 4 games, turn CPU INT down.

            Just play a few games and take notes on different things. Try not to change sliders after every game unless it's something you majorly can't stand. On default All-Pro, I turned down RBK because I was getting 6-10 yards a carry!

            Play a few games to get a feel for it, don't quit after a game and change things.

            And remember, things I rarely see addressed on sliders; top HBs average 4-5 yards per carry. Average. Not every carry. The one reason I hate most sliders on these forums. Getting around 100 yards a game is unlikely, even the best in the league have their 20-40-yard days.

              Re: Help choosing sliders

              There are three constants I've realized playing this game the last few months. They are game speed, threshold, and tackling. All effect each other. For example, if you play on slow, then threshold should be 75 and tackle should be 75. If you play on fast, threshold should be 25, tackle at 25. Normal would be 50 for both. Very slow would be 100's. Very Fast would be 0's. Try to stick with this formula when adjusting your slider set.
